Practical Metal Finishing - Frequently, the polishing of metal is required for aesthetics or clean-room usages. It really is one of the more accepted processes simply because of its utility in boosting the overall attractiveness of the item, such as, motorbike parts, vehicle parts or kitchenware. Besides that, lots of clean-rooms would need a burnished finish so to limit the permeability of the material that may cause debris to collect and contaminate. A superb instance of this use could be in a vacuum chamber.

You'll discover a large number of ways to polish metals, and let's take a review of examples of the processes required. Metals may be burnished electromechanically, chemically, manually, or with purpose built buffing machines. A particular finishing paste or compound is regularly used, that might contain dolomite, aluminum oxide, tripoli, chromium oxide, limestone, chalk,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, due to its lousy th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its comparatively high viscidness is considered the most time intensive. Alternatively, merchandise crafted from non-ferrous metals are usually more responsive to polishing, as they need the minimum number of treatments.

A lesser pad speed must be used if a high quality mirror finish is necessary. Polishing buffs smothered with paste are substantially impacted by specific pressures on the polishing pad. The concentration of the surface pressure may be increased within certain ranges, but going over the ideal level of load not simply cuts down on the quality level of treatment, but in addition degrades performance, may well cause wear to the part, plus there is additionally an evident overheating of the work-pieces, because of friction. When you are working on thin metal, it will be increased temperature (and a relating flexibility of the metal) which can cause elements to twist, buckle or flex. In general, it needs a highly trained technician to look at all these elements to both avoid harm to the part and to deliver the results correctly. For you to significantly enhance the standard of the resultant finish, the polishing operation is required to be completed with a lot less aggression and not as much pressure so that you may in time deliver a surface without scratches or fine lines left behind by the finishing procedure, thus arriving at a shiny mirror finish.
